**Title: The Power of Commitment**


**Scripture Reading: Ruth 1:16-17**

*"But Ruth replied, 'Don’t urge me to leave you or to turn back from you. Where you go, I will go, and where you stay, I will stay. Your people will be my people and your God my God. Where you die I will die, and there I will be buried. May the Lord deal with me, be it ever so severely, if even death separates you and me.’”*


**Reflection:**

Commitment is a powerful force that can transform lives, deepen relationships, and reveal God's purposes. In the story of Ruth, we see one of the most beautiful examples of commitment in the Bible. Ruth chose to stay with her mother-in-law, Naomi, even though it meant leaving her homeland, family, and comfort behind. Her unwavering dedication not only changed her life but positioned her to become part of God’s redemptive plan through the lineage of Jesus Christ.


Commitment requires more than words; it demands action, sacrifice, and trust in God's faithfulness. Whether in marriage, ministry, or daily responsibilities, a committed heart reflects God's character. He is faithful to His promises, never leaving or forsaking us (Deuteronomy 31:6). When we commit our ways to Him, we experience His guidance and peace (Proverbs 3:5-6).


**The Power of Commitment:**

1. **It Brings Clarity:** Commitment aligns our priorities and removes distractions. When we are committed to a goal, relationship, or purpose, we can focus on what truly matters.

2. **It Builds Strength:** Challenges will come, but commitment gives us the resolve to press on. Like Ruth, we trust that God will provide and sustain us.

3. **It Reflects God's Love:** True commitment mirrors God's unconditional love. It reminds us of Christ's commitment to redeem humanity through the cross.
